/* Arquivo CSS para Temas sem tabelas - Tem Clean */

@font-face {
    font-family: 'hapticextrabold';
    src: url('http://www.aregiao.com.br/fontes/haptic-extrabold-webfont.eot');
    src: url('http://www.aregiao.com.br/fontes/haptic-extrabold-webfont.eot?#iefix') format('embedded-opentype'),
         src: url('http://www.aregiao.com.br/fontes/haptic-extrabold-webfont.woff') format('woff'),
         src: url('http://www.aregiao.com.br/fontes/haptic-extrabold-webfont.ttf') format('truetype'),
         src: url('http://www.aregiao.com.br/fontes/haptic-extrabold-webfont.svg#hapticextrabold') format('svg');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family: 'cora_basicregular';
    src: url('http://www.aregiao.com.br/fontes/corabasic-regular-webfont.eot');
    src: url('http://www.aregiao.com.br/fontes/corabasic-regular-webfont.eot?#iefix') format('embedded-opentype'),
         src: url('http://www.aregiao.com.br/fontes/corabasic-regular-webfont.woff') format('woff'),
         src: url('http://www.aregiao.com.br/fontes/corabasic-regular-webfont.ttf') format('truetype'),
         src: url('http://www.aregiao.com.br/fontes/corabasic-regular-webfont.svg#cora_basicregular') format('svg');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family: 'maratstdregular';
    src: url('http://www.aregiao.com.br/fontes/maratstd-regular-webfont.eot');
    src: url('http://www.aregiao.com.br/fontes/maratstd-regular-webfont.eot?#iefix') format('embedded-opentype'),
         src: url('http://www.aregiao.com.br/fontes/maratstd-regular-webfont.woff') format('woff'),
         src: url('http://www.aregiao.com.br/fontes/maratstd-regular-webfont.ttf') format('truetype'),
         src: url('http://www.aregiao.com.br/fontes/maratstd-regular-webfont.svg#maratstdregular') format('svg');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family: 'ubuntubold';
    src: url('http://www.aregiao.com.br/fontes/ubuntu-bold-webfont.eot');
    src: url('http://www.aregiao.com.br/fontes/ubuntu-bold-webfont.eot?#iefix') format('embedded-opentype'),
         src: url('http://www.aregiao.com.br/fontes/ubuntu-bold-webfont.woff') format('woff'),
         src: url('http://www.aregiao.com.br/fontes/ubuntu-bold-webfont.ttf') format('truetype'),
         src: url('http://www.aregiao.com.br/fontes/ubuntu-bold-webfont.svg#ubuntubold') format('svg');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family: 'ubunturegular';
    src: url('http://www.aregiao.com.br/fontes/ubuntu-regular-webfont.eot');
    src: url('http://www.aregiao.com.br/fontes/ubuntu-regular-webfont.eot?#iefix') format('embedded-opentype'),
         src: url('http://www.aregiao.com.br/fontes/ubuntu-regular-webfont.woff') format('woff'),
         src: url('http://www.aregiao.com.br/fontes/ubuntu-regular-webfont.ttf') format('truetype'),
         src: url('http://www.aregiao.com.br/fontes/ubuntu-regular-webfont.svg#ubunturegular') format('svg');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family: 'merriweather_sansregular';
    src: url('merriweathersans-regular-webfont.eot');
    src: url('merriweathersans-regular-webfont.eot?#iefix') format('embedded-opentype'),
         url('merriweathersans-regular-webfont.woff') format('woff'),
         url('merriweathersans-regular-webfont.ttf') format('truetype'),
         url('merriweathersans-regular-webfont.svg#merriweather_sansregular') format('svg');
    font-weight: normal;
    font-style: normal;
}

@font-face {
    font-family: 'merriweather_sansbold';
    src: url('merriweathersans-bold-webfont.eot');
    src: url('merriweathersans-bold-webfont.eot?#iefix') format('embedded-opentype'),
         url('merriweathersans-bold-webfont.woff') format('woff'),
         url('merriweathersans-bold-webfont.ttf') format('truetype'),
         url('merriweathersans-bold-webfont.svg#merriweather_sansbold') format('svg');
    font-weight: normal;
    font-style: normal;
}

font.titulo4 {font-family: Haptic, 'Haptic Extrabold',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 32px;line-height: 120%;}

font.titulo6 {font-family: Haptic, 'Haptic Extrabold',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 24px;line-height: 120%;}

font.titulo5 {font-family: Haptic, 'Haptic Extrabold',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 22px;line-height: 120%;}

font.titulo {font-family: Haptic, 'Haptic Extrabold',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 24px;line-height: 120%;}

font.texto {font-family: 'Cora Basic',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 20px;line-height: 130%;}

font.textocora {font-family: 'Cora Basic', ubuntu, MaratStd, Maratstd, maratstd, 'MaratStd Regular',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 16px;line-height: 100%;color:black;}

font.textocora2 {font-family: 'Cora Basic', ubuntu, MaratStd, Maratstd, maratstd, 'MaratStd Regular',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 20px;line-height: 150%;}

font.lateral {font-family: Ubuntu, ubuntu, 'Ubuntu Regular',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 16px;line-height: 100%;font-weight: 300; }

font.lateralb {font-family: Ubuntu, ubuntu, 'Ubuntu Regular',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 16px;line-height: 100%;font-weight: 700; }

font.lateralp {font-family: Ubuntu, ubuntu, 'Ubuntu Regular',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 16px;line-height: 100%; }

font.lateralc {font-family: Ubuntu, ubuntu, 'Ubuntu Regular',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 18px;line-height: 110%;font-weight: 600; }

font.lateral16 {font-family: 'Cora Basic', ubuntu, 'Ubuntu Regular',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 15px;line-height: 90%;font-weight: 100; }

font.lateral16b {font-family: Ubuntu, ubuntu, 'Ubuntu Regular',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 16px;line-height: 100%;font-weight: 600; }

h2.data {
	font-family: ubuntu, Ubuntu, 'Ubuntu Regular', "Trebuchet MS", Verdana, arial, sans-serif;
	font-size: 8px;
	line-height: 100%;}
}

h2.date {
	font-family: ubuntu, Ubuntu, 'Ubuntu Regular', "Trebuchet MS", Verdana, arial, sans-serif;
	font-size: 10px;
	line-height: 100%;}
}

.blog h4 {
    font-family: Haptic, haptic, 'Haptic Extrabold', 'Trebuchet MS', Verdana, sans-serif;
    font-size: 32px;
    text-align: left;
    margin-bottom: 5px;
}

.blog h5 {
    font-family: MarastStd, maratstd, Maratstd, 'Maratstd Regular', 'MaratStd Regular', MaratStd, Maratstd, maratstd, serif;
    font-size: 16px;
    text-align: left;
    margin-bottom: 5px;
}

h5.bank {
    font-family: Ubuntu, 'Ubuntu Regular', 'Trebuchet MS', Verdana, sans-serif;
    font-size: 22px;
    text-align: left;
    line-height: 120%;
    margin-bottom: 5px;
}

h5.bank-w {
    font-family: Ubuntu, 'Ubuntu Regular', 'Trebuchet MS', Verdana, sans-serif;
    font-size: 14px;
    text-align: left;
   color:white;
    line-height: 120%;
    margin-bottom: 5px;
}

h3.title2 {
	 font-family: 'Cora Basic', ubuntu; verdana;
    font-size: 24px;
    font-weight: bold;
    margin-bottom: 0px;
}

.blog p {
    font-family: 'Cora Basic', ubuntu, 'Ubuntu Regular', 'Trebuchet MS', Verdana, sans-serif;
    font-size: 16px;
    font-weight: normal;
    line-height: 120%;
    text-align: left;
    margin-bottom: 0px;
}

.blogtitle {
	 font-family: 'Cora Basic', ubuntu;
    font-size: 16px;
    font-weight: bold;
    line-height: 100%;
    margin-bottom: 0px;
}

.blogbody {
    font-family: 'Cora Basic', ubuntu, 'Ubuntu Regular', 'Trebuchet MS', Verdana, sans-serif;
    font-size: 16px;
    font-weight: normal;
    line-height: 150%;
    text-align: left;
    margin-bottom: 0px;
}

.blog.blogbody {
    font-family: 'Cora Basic', ubuntu, 'Ubuntu Regular', 'Trebuchet MS', Verdana, sans-serif;
    font-size: 16px;
    font-weight: normal;
    line-height: 150%;
    text-align: left;
    margin-bottom: 0px;
}

table.uol {
	padding:			0;
	margin:				0;
	border:				0;
	width:			1260px;
	margin-left: 0;
	background: #000000;
}

td.uol {
	padding:			0px;
	margin:				0;
	border: 0;
	width:			1260px;
	background: #000000;
}

td.rodape {
	padding:			5px;
	margin:				0;
	border: 0;
	width:			1260px;
	background: #ffd700;
}

img.img2 {
   border: 0px solid #000000;
	padding: 5px;
   margin: 5px 5px 5px 5px;
}

img {
   border: 0px solid #000000;
	padding: 5px;
   margin: 5px 5px 5px 5px;
}

img.img1 {
   border: 1px solid #000000;
	padding: 0px;
}

font.data {
	font:	14px ubuntu, 'Ubuntu Regular', "Trebuchet MS", Lucida Grande, Verdana, Arial, Sans-Serif;
     font-weight: 900; 
}

font.lateral {
	font:	14px Ubuntu, ubuntu, 'Ubuntu Regular', Verdana, Arial, Sans-Serif;
	font-weight: 500;
}

font.titulo {
	font:	14px 'Haptic Extrabold', ubuntu, "Trebuchet MS", Verdana, Arial, Sans-Serif;
	font-weight: 100; 
     line-height: 100%;
}

font.title {
	font:	16px Ubuntu, ubuntu, 'Ubuntu Regular', 'Haptic Extrabold', "Trebuchet MS", Verdana, Arial, Sans-Serif;
     line-height: 100%;
}

h1 {font-family: 'Haptic Extrabold','Cora Basic', Haptic, 'Haptic Extrabold', hapticextrabold, 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 32px;font-weight: 100;line-height: 0%;}

font.titulo4 {font-family: Haptic, 'Haptic Extrabold',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 32px;line-height: 120%;}

td.menu-h2 {
	width: 1260px;
	background: #ffd700;
	text-align: right;
	border: 0;
	border-top: solid;
	border-top-width: thin;
	border-top-color: #000000;
	border-bottom: solid;
	border-bottom-width: thin;
	border-bottom-color: #000000;
}

td.lateral1 {
	width: 170px;
	background: #EFFAA4;
	text-align: center;
	vertical-align: top;
	padding-top: 12px;
	padding-left: 0px;
	padding-right: 0px;
}


td.lateral2 {
	width: 410px;
	background: #dddddd;
	text-align: left;
	vertical-align: top;
	padding-top: 15px;
	padding-left: 5px;
	padding-right: 5px;
}

td.logo {
	width: 360px;
	height: 110px;
	background: #ffffff;
	padding-left: 20px;
}

.boxM {
	width: 800px;
	border: 2;
	border: dotted;
	border-width: 4px;
	border-color: #000000;
	padding: 20px;
}

/* --- the body --- */ 
body {
   font-family: MaratStd, ubuntu, Ubuntu, 'Ubuntu Regular", "Trebuchet MS", Verdana, arial, sans-serif;
   font-size: 16px;
	text-align:			left;
	margin:				0;
	margin-left: 10px;
	margin-right: 10px;
	margin-top: 10px;
}

/* --- the headers --- */

h2 {font-family: 'Cora Basic', Ubuntu, ubuntu, 'Ubuntu Regular',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 18px;line-height: 130%;font-weight: 600; }

h3 {font-family: 'Cora Basic', Ubuntu, ubuntu, 'Ubuntu Regular',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;font-size: 18px;line-height: 50%;font-weight: 600; }

h4 {
	font-family: 'Cora Basic', Ubuntu, ubuntu, 'Ubuntu Regular', ubuntu, "Trebuchet MS", sans-serif, arial, Verdana;
	font-size: 28px;
	line-height: 110%;
	font-weight: 600;
 }

h4.titulo4 {
	color:				#000000;
	font-size:			32px;
	font-family: Haptic, haptic, 'Haptic Extrabold', Ubuntu, 'Ubuntu Regular', "Trebuchet MS", Verdana, arial, sans-serif;
   line-height: 100%;
}

h5 {
	font-family: MaratStd, Maratstd, maratstd, 'Maratstd Regular', 'MaratStd Regular', MaratStd, Maratstd, maratstd, serif;
	font-size: 16px;
	line-height: 110%;}

h5.texto {
	font-family: MaratStd, Maratstd, maratstd, 'Maratstd Regular', 'MaratStd Regular', MaratStd, Maratstd, maratstd, serif;
	font-weight: 100;
	font-size: 16px;
	line-height: 110%;}

h6 {
	font-size: 10px;
	line-height: 100%;}

h6.date {
	font-family: Ubuntu, 'Ubuntu Regular', 'Trebuchet MS', Verdana, arial, sans-serif;
	font-size: 10px;
	line-height: 110%;}

div.box100 { border: solid; border-width: thin; width: 410px; padding: 5px; background: #ffffff; }

div.boxyel { border: none; width: 100%; background: #ffd700; padding: 0.1em; }

a:link {text-decoration: none;color:#2F75DC;}

a:hover {text-decoration:underline;color:#00aaaa;}

a:visited {text-decoration: none;color:#666666;}

a.lp:link {text-decoration: none;color:#000000;}

a.lp:hover {text-decoration:underline;color:#000000;}

a.lp:visited {text-decoration: none;color:#666666;}
